  • Big Tragedy In Kerala Temple 100 Were Died And Around 400 Were Injured.

    Disaster stuck to the crowd of Puttingal Devi Temple at Paravur, south of Kollam at 3:30 pm when entire bump of fire crackers burst. Due to this explosion the Meena-Bharani festival exploded and at the spot 40 persons were killed instantly as well as it affects the nearby buildings. Some eyewitness said that this disaster happen when a cracker meant to explode in the air fell to the ground and it spread sparks flying in all directions. That spark reached the storehouse, igniting fireworks stored there. This explosion caused damage to several structures in the vicinity.The quantity of people died in this incident was around 110 and 400 were injured.

    Really sad news!! Many people died and injured by this fire tragedy. Even roof of temple and houses in vicinity were also damaged. People over there ran around in panic, when blast cut off the power supply in temple complex, plunging it into darkness. Rescue went on all night and victims had been taken out of the rubble.

      Sources said there was uncertainty regarding the fireworks show till Saturday afternoon, hours before it began. “But the temple authorities managed to get the support of political parties. The fireworks display is held dear by many, it is an emotional issue. It was only in the evening that the temple announced that the show would be held.
